Our Environment team is solving some of Australia’s biggest challenges. We are preserving and improving our built and natural environments, finding ways to use and re-use our resources, and building safe and future ready infrastructure to support places where communities can thrive.

Our recent projects/clients include:

- ** University of Melbourne **- environmental assessment and remediation of the complex former Holden site in Port Melbourne, to support redevelopment of this prize location as a future learning campus
- ** Orica Australia **- environmental assessment, probabilistic cost and volume modelling, and soil and groundwater remediation to support Audit of the two main Orica sites in Victoria: Yarraville and Deer Park
- ** Viva Energy** - geotechnical and environmental assessment, environmental management and compliance, boundary containment system operation and maintenance, contamination management and operations environmental services

As a Environmental Risk Assessor, you will be part of a group of multi-skilled professionals, conduct fieldwork across Melbourne and be involved in supporting human health and ecological risk assessments (HHERA) in client projects, including environmental investigations, assessments and remediation of contaminated sites driven by risk to human health and environment.

**What you’ll do**
- Assist with the collection of data that supports contaminated site investigations, chemical assessments, human health and ecological risk assessments
- Conduct literature searches, and reviews and interpretation of scientific information (e.g., biology, chemistry, toxicology and ecotoxicology studies)
- Manage and evaluate chemical and biological datasets, generate statistical metrics, and run simple models
- Manage the preparation and presentation of data outputs (such as graphs, pie charts, box plots)
- Undertake quality assurance and validation data checking
- Contribute to the preparation of human health and ecological risk assessment reports
- Support the preparation of proposals that relate to risk assessment and/or contaminated site investigations
